Thoracentesis(Thoracocentesis), commonly known as pleural tap, is a medical procedure where a 22 gauge needle is inserted into the pleural space, the area between the lung and chest wall. This procedure is commonly performed to diagnose or treat various respiratory disorders.

Uniportal vs. multiportal thoracoscopic segmentectomy: a north American study.

Ilitch Diaz-Gutierrez1, Charles Antoine Menier2, Félix H Savoie-White2

  • 1Department of Surgery, Division of Thoracic and Foregut Surgery, University of Minnesota, Minneapolis, MN, USA.

Journal of Thoracic Disease
|March 13, 2023
PubMed
Summary

Uniportal video-assisted thoracoscopic surgery (VATS) segmentectomy shows comparable outcomes to multiportal VATS in North American centers. Experienced surgeons achieve similar results in operating time, complications, and hospital stay for both VATS approaches.

Area of Science:

  • Thoracic Surgery
  • Minimally Invasive Surgery
  • Surgical Oncology

Background:

  • Uniportal video-assisted thoracoscopic surgery (VATS) segmentectomy is increasingly adopted globally.
  • North American experience with uniportal VATS segmentectomy remains limited.
  • This study compares uniportal versus multiportal VATS segmentectomy in a North American multicenter setting.

Purpose of the Study:

  • To compare the outcomes of uniportal VATS segmentectomy with multiportal VATS segmentectomy.
  • To evaluate the feasibility and safety of uniportal VATS segmentectomy in North America.
  • To assess perioperative data and postoperative complications between the two VATS approaches.

Main Methods:

  • Retrospective chart review of prospectively collected data from two North American centers (2012-2020).
  • Inclusion of all VATS segmentectomy patients, excluding emergent cases and combined resections.
  • Propensity score matching (1:1) to compare outcomes between uniportal and multiportal VATS cohorts.

Main Results:

  • A total of 423 VATS segmentectomies were performed (181 uniportal, 242 multiportal).
  • Operating time was significantly lower for uniportal VATS (130 min) compared to multiportal VATS (161 min) (P<0.001).
  • No significant differences were observed in estimated blood loss, severe complications, conversion rates, resection margins, nodal upstaging, hospital stay, or 30-day mortality.

Conclusions:

  • Uniportal VATS segmentectomy demonstrates comparable postoperative outcomes to multiportal VATS segmentectomy.
  • In experienced hands, uniportal VATS is a safe and effective alternative for lung segmentectomy in North America.
  • The findings support the wider adoption of uniportal VATS segmentectomy in the region.
